Genomic Data Storage Solutions

Genomic-data-storage-solutions refer to advanced methods and technologies designed to efficiently store, manage, and secure large volumes of genomic data generated from DNA sequencing efforts. These solutions are crucial for supporting research, personalized medicine, and biotechnological advancements by providing scalable, reliable, and secure data storage infrastructures tailored to the unique needs of genomic information.

Key Features

  • High-capacity storage capabilities to handle massive datasets
  • Data encryption and security measures to protect sensitive genetic information
  • Scalability to accommodate growing genomic data volumes
  • Fast retrieval and access speeds for efficient data analysis
  • Integration with cloud computing platforms for flexibility and collaboration
  • Data redundancy and backup systems to prevent loss
  • Compliance with data privacy regulations such as HIPAA or GDPR

Pros

  • Enables efficient management and analysis of large-scale genomic datasets
  • Supports personalized medicine initiatives by providing secure data infrastructure
  • Facilitates collaboration across research institutions through cloud integration
  • Enhances data security and privacy protections

Cons

  • Can be costly to implement and maintain at scale
  • Requires specialized technical expertise for optimal management
  • Potential risks related to data breaches if security measures are inadequate
  • Rapid technological obsolescence may necessitate frequent upgrades
